PANTONE 1395 is a dark orange color with a hexadecimal value of #A06928.

It has a hue angle of 33 degrees, which means it is a warm color.

This color has a red component of 62.75%, a green component of 41.18%, and a blue component of 15.69%.

PANTONE 1395 can be used for various purposes, such as branding, packaging, graphic design, and fashion.

The complementary color of PANTONE 1395 is PANTONE 7450, which is a dark blue color with a hexadecimal value of #164F99.

The complementary color is the opposite color on the color wheel, and it creates contrast and balance when used together.

PANTONE 1395 can also be paired with other colors that have similar hues, such as PANTONE 1385, PANTONE 1405, and PANTONE 1415.

These colors create harmony and unity when used together.
